In this review of the LC-LC OM2 Fiber Patch Cable the bottom line is clear: it is a practical, no-frills choice for short-range, high-bandwidth links in racks and patch panels. The cable uses genuine Corning OM2 50/125m multimode glass and LC-LC connectors with ceramic ferrules to deliver reliable, low-loss performance for data center and telecom patching. For network engineers who need a durable duplex patch lead that supports 10Gb and higher short-range Ethernet, this cable balances signal integrity and physical flexibility without unnecessary extras.
Key Features
- OM2 multimode glass: Provides a 50/125m fiber core optimized for short-range high-bandwidth links common in enterprise networks.
- LC-LC connectors: Compact LC connectors with ceramic ferrules give precise alignment and reduced insertion loss for consistent signal delivery.
- Supports multiple speeds: Rated for 1Gb, 10Gb, 40Gb, and 100Gb short-range links at defined distances, making it versatile for upgrades.
- Reinforced zip-cord jacket: The 2.0mm jacket resists kinks and improves handling during rack and conduit installation.
- ANSI/TIA/EIA compliance: Each cable is inspected and tested to industry standards for dependable, long-term performance.
Who It's For
The cable suits network technicians and system architects installing patch panels, rack-mounted switches, and short-run backbone links in data centers, telecom rooms, and enterprise closets. Its Corning glass core and ceramic ferrules are especially useful where low insertion loss and repeatable connections matter.
Those who require long-haul fiber, outdoor-rated runs, or single-mode links for campus or metro spans should look for single-mode or outdoor-specific products instead, since OM2 multimode is intended for short-range multimode applications.

Specifications
| Fiber type | OM2 multimode 50/125m |
| Length | 50M (164.04ft) |
| Connectors | LC to LC duplex with ceramic ferrules |
| Bandwidth | 1500/2000 MHz-km at 850nm/1300nm |
| Supported Ethernet | 1Gb (550m), 10Gb (300m), 40Gb (100m), 100Gb (short-range) |
| Jacket | Reinforced zip-cord 2.0mm |
| Standards | ANSI/TIA/EIA inspected and tested |

Frequently Asked Questions
Can this cable handle 10Gb Ethernet?
Yes. As OM2 multimode it supports 10Gb Ethernet up to the specified short-range distances (around 300m for 10Gb).
Are the connectors durable for repeated use?
Yes. The LC connectors use ceramic ferrules designed for low insertion loss and frequent mating cycles.
Is this cable suitable for outdoor runs?
No. The reinforced zip-cord jacket is intended for indoor rack and patching use; outdoor or direct-burial runs require outdoor-rated or single-mode alternatives.
